Good morning 

I have a question related to public funds due to COVID. Recently someone told me about tax relief due to working from home and work expenses during covid (https://www.gov.uk/tax-relief-for-emplo ... ng-at-home) ;

Does this count as public funds for immigration purpose ? I need to apply for my indefinite leave to remain this month so I want to know if it affects it.

Another question

During last year may to july 2021 I went back to my country due to the lockdown we were in, I was in furlough so I though I spend the time with my family. I didnt cross the 180 days threshold during a rolling year or anything and my employer obviously knew about it and it's in the letter they gave me to support my ILR but since I was there for 2 months it was obviously more than annual leave duration (also airports were closed and I couldn't fly back earlier) my question is this: does t affect my ILR? Do I need to provide anything related to airports closure ? Or no simply the letter from my employer detailing all my absences is enough?

Thank you all

Employment-related tax relief is NOT related to public funds. There is no requirement that your absence must be less than the usual annual leave :? No extra documents needed
